The 5th Infantry Battalion in Katha District has issued a warning and order, dated July 20, to the public residing within its territory, strictly prohibiting any involvement or connection with the interim government's military, and has imposed a night curfew in some areas. The 5th Infantry Battalion, Katha District, under the 1st Military Command, which is under the National Unity Government (NUG), has earnestly warned all parents and citizens residing in its territory who are engaged in gold mining and other economic activities not to associate with the military or to generate "blood money." Furthermore, it has prohibited providing information to the military, gathering information, and acting as spies, stating that any cooperation or involvement with the military that would harm the entire revolution, for any reason, is strictly forbidden. It has been severely warned that if individuals continue to cooperate or associate with the military without adhering to the warnings, strict action will be taken. Concurrently, due to intense fighting occurring within Katha District, an order has been issued to restrict movement on certain road sections with time limitations. It is understood that this restriction is being imposed to prevent harm to civilians, as the interim government's military is using civilian vehicles to transport personnel and military equipment along all routes branching off the Mandalay-Bhamo Union Highway, including the eastern Ayeyarwaddy region and the Ingyee-Nyaungpinkwin road. The 5th Infantry Battalion in Katha District has warned that movement on these road sections and their branches is prohibited between 7 PM and 5 AM, starting from July 20, 2026. It has requested that local residents be aware of and respect this local decree, and stated that it will not be responsible for any subsequent problems or issues arising from non-compliance and indiscipline. The announcement, signed by the commander of the 5th Infantry Battalion in Katha District, stated that the exact date for the withdrawal of this time-limited order will be announced in a subsequent statement.
